Attribute | Details |
---|---|
Full Name | Toby Keith Covel |
Date of Birth | July 8, 1961 |
Birthplace | Clinton, Oklahoma |
Occupation | Country Music Singer, Songwriter, Actor, Record Producer |
Genre | Country |
Notable Hits | "Should've Been a Cowboy," "Courtesy of the Red, White and Blue," "Beer for My Horses" |
Awards | American Country Music Awards, Academy of Country Music Awards |
Record Label | Show Dog Nashville |
Parents | Hubert Keith Covel (Father), Carolyn Joan Covel (Mother) |
Spouse | Tricia Lucus (m. 1984) |
Children | Shelley Covel, Krystal Keith, Stelen Covel |
Education | Moore High School (Oklahoma) |
Official Website | tobykeith.com |
Hubert Keith Covel, Toby's father, was more than just a parent; he was a Vietnam War veteran, a man whose experiences in service instilled a deep sense of patriotism and duty within his son. This influence resonated throughout Toby's career, shaping his songwriting and performance style. Huberts work ethic, honed through his various jobs, including horse training, served as a powerful lesson for young Toby. This dedication to hard work became a cornerstone of Tobys own approach to his burgeoning music career.

Huberts influence extended beyond the practical. He passed away in 2001 after battling cancer, leaving an undeniable void in Tobys life. The bond they shared, and the values Hubert instilled, became a source of strength and inspiration for Toby. The lessons learned from his father continue to echo through Toby's life and career, a testament to the enduring power of paternal guidance.
